Medication Interactions Certain medications reduce the absorption of methylcobalamin, cyanocobalamin, and other B12 supplements, including: Proton pump inhibitors (omeprazole, esomeprazole, and lansoprazole) H2-receptor antagonists (cimetidine, famotidine, and ranitidine) Metformin Colchicine Cholestyramine Certain antibiotics (neomycin and chloramphenicol) If you use these or other medications, talk with a healthcare provider about ways to maintain healthy levels of B12.
